Publisher's Synopsis

Looking closely at the story of Ethan Allen (1738-1789), the popular American Revolutionist and Vermont hero, Duffy and Mueller examine how this story was based partly on historical records and, equally significantly, on the personal, economic, and social needs the story fulfilled for later generations of Vermonters, whilst exploring the ambiguities, confusion and mythology surrounding the life and accomplishments of the famous icon and so-called heroic pioneer.
